Transaction 09af3ca66b6aebb935dc34a4c9419f3ec7f1fff829f75dab400a52c0ca83bb5e
1 Input
1 Output
-
09af3ca66b6aebb935dc34a4c9419f3ec7f1fff829f75dab400a52c0ca83bb5e:0
- value
- 166156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 880a5af0186b209e99fa048b14053d4af7c44aaf OP_EQUAL
- address
- 3E6LE8HW3cE8Ya193kGiUaeDt5AcP222XB